Output fdafb83335fe577d30310bc50af09715ff8fd9ad5fb9121eda336b3ea4891455:1

value
2517709
script pubkey
OP_0 OP_PUSHBYTES_20 3e58ad5b41f8d038bd7a94483326406f192c5eb9
address
bc1q8ev26k6plrgr30t6j3yrxfjqduvjch4eegk4x7
transaction
fdafb83335fe577d30310bc50af09715ff8fd9ad5fb9121eda336b3ea4891455
spent
true